How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 60406?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 60406 Studio Apartments | $975 | $800 | $1,150 |
| 60406 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,174 | $874 | $1,500 |
| 60406 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,388 | $1,073 | $1,950 |
| 60406 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,712 | $1,475 | $1,950 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 60406 ZIP Code
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 60406 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 60406 ranges from $874 to $1,500 with an average monthly rent of $1,174.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 60406 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 60406 range from $1,073 to $1,950.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,388.
